Mixing and binding - the ground feedstock is mixed with binding agents, usually a natural adhesive such as lignin or starch, to enhance the cohesiveness and toughness of your briquettes. The binder assists the particles adhere with each other for the duration of compression

The first briquettes ended up often known as culm bombs and had been hand-moulded with somewhat moist clay like a binder. These might be difficult to burn up efficiently, as the unburned clay developed a substantial ash written content, blocking airflow through a grate.
